This project calls GitHub API to get repositories under Apache organization, sorts and filters out top 5 repositories. It also filters top 10 contributors to each repository. All the data is saved in H2 in-memory database using Hibernate.
This project saves the data in two tables:
- Repository
- Contributor
Thus, making a one-to-many relationship between repository and contributor.
